Tubby Smith says he'll be back next season

MINNEAPOLIS (AP) -- Minnesota coach Tubby Smith says he expects to be back at Minnesota next season.

Several reports on Monday said Smith was close to replacing John Pelphrey at Arkansas. Smith appeared on his weekly radio show on WCCO-AM Monday night and was asked if he expected to return.

Smith said, "Yes I do."

The coach said he is continuing to work on a two-year extension with athletic director Joel Maturi. Smith has wanted a new practice facility ever since he arrived in 2007, but the school has not been able to raise the necessary funds to make that happen yet.

Smith just wrapped up a disappointing fourth season in Minnesota. The Gophers lost 10 of their last 11 games and did not receive a bid to the NCAA or NIT tournaments.
